Minimize book changes
In 2025, the review of curriculum and textbooks will be carried out in the context of the whole country implementing the arrangement of provincial-level administrative units according to Resolution No. 202/2025/QH15 dated June 12, 2025 of the National Assembly on the arrangement of provincial-level administrative units.
Based on the review, the Ministry of Education and Training (MOET) has identified a number of subjects that are directly affected by the change of administrative boundaries, including: History and Geography for grades 4, 5, and 9; Geography for grade 12; History and Economic and Legal Education for grade 10. These subjects will take steps according to regulations to revise the subject curriculum as a basis for revising textbooks, such as updating requirements, knowledge content, place names, data, maps, charts, and socio-economic information, etc.
According to the Ministry of Education and Training , the revision of subject programs is carried out on the principle of minimizing changes to textbooks and strengthening guidance so that teachers and schools can proactively implement the program according to their authority to suit reality.
The 2018 General Education Program represents the general education goals, ensuring a unified orientation and core, compulsory educational content for students. Textbooks specify the content of the Program and are identified as important learning materials and documents for schools to choose to organize teaching. Teachers and schools are given the right to proactively arrange learning topics, update and supplement content to suit the students, teaching and learning conditions and practical conditions.
Therefore, in the 2025-2026 school year, teachers and schools will continue to use the current curriculum and textbooks, while being responsible for proactively selecting and adjusting teaching materials, lessons, and topics to suit local realities and the two-level government model.
In the coming time, the Ministry of Education and Training will issue documents directing and guiding localities and schools to implement continuously, without interruption and in accordance with reality.
Urgent review and implementation
The Ministry of Education and Training said that it is urgently completing the review and assessment of the implementation of the 2018 general education program to update and adjust a number of subjects to ensure that the program is implemented in accordance with reality; better meeting the requirements of innovation and the country's socio-economic development through each period. Among them, there are subjects affected by administrative boundary adjustments. The Ministry of Education and Training will guide publishers, organizations and individuals with approved textbooks to make necessary adjustments to update new administrative information in the direction of ensuring the stability of textbooks and effectiveness in teaching and learning.
Regarding local education content, based on Resolution No. 202/2025/QH15 of the National Assembly on the arrangement of provincial-level administrative units, on the basis of the framework program and documents issued by the Ministry of Education and Training, localities proactively select and develop local education content, ensuring that it is consistent with the characteristics of the new administrative unit and the two-level local government organization model, promoting local initiative in organizing program implementation, while ensuring that education content is promptly updated according to new administrative and social changes.
Regarding textbook publishing units, Associate Professor, Dr. Nguyen Van Tung, Member of the Board of Members, Deputy Editor-in-Chief of Vietnam Education Publishing House, said that Vietnam Education Publishing House has directed its member units to organize drafts and editorial boards to review and compile statistics on content requirements, knowledge, data, place names, maps, charts, socio-economic information, related to changes in administrative boundaries and two-level government, and report to the Ministry of Education and Training for instructions on corrections. After the Ministry of Education and Training issues the revised and updated content in the curriculum of a number of subjects as announced by the Ministry of Education and Training, Vietnam Education Publishing House will proceed to correct the textbooks and submit them to the Ministry of Education and Training for approval according to the correct procedure.
Accordingly, the principle of textbook revision must closely follow and update the content of the requirements to be achieved, knowledge, data, place names, maps, charts, socio-economic information, etc., on the principle of minimizing the revision of textbook content. The Ministry of Education and Training will have specific instructions on this, with the spirit that schools and teachers will be proactive in adjusting materials, lesson content, and teaching topics based on the local reality and the two-level government.
Vietnam Education Publishing House will actively support schools and teachers in using current textbooks in accordance with the direction of the Ministry of Education and Training.
